H1 2026 (Media) earnings summary
6 Aug, 2026Executive summary
Sustained strong results in H1 2026, with underlying profit up nearly 60% year-over-year, driven by robust performances in the Netherlands, Germany, and Poland.
Market share increased, especially in the Polish poultry sector, supported by acquisitions and joint ventures.
Strategic focus on innovation, sustainability, and value chain integration, including partnerships and new product launches.
Financial highlights
Total volume rose 5.1% to 5.45 million tonnes; compound feed volume up 3.3%.
Revenue increased 0.3% to €1,577.1 million; like-for-like revenue declined 4.8% due to lower raw material costs.
Gross profit up 12.6% to €327.3 million; underlying EBITDA up 39.3% to €84.7 million.
Underlying EBIT rose 59.8% to €57.2 million; underlying net profit attributable to shareholders up 59.4% to €37.3 million.
Underlying EPS increased 55.6% to €0.42.
Net cash from operating activities fell to €44.9 million (H1 2025: €63.8 million); net debt at €22.4 million.
ROACE on underlying EBIT improved to 22.0% from 14.3% year-over-year.
Outlook and guidance
New financial targets to be announced at Capital Markets Day at year-end, reflecting improved performance and the impact of the KPS joint venture.
Continued focus on sustainable livestock farming, innovation, and value chain integration.
